Overview

There are 9 types of other business comprise

(1) Operation and Maintenance Business, (2) Management Services Business for Power Plant, (3) Coal Mining Business, (4) LNG Shipper Business, (5) A Clean Energy Project Development, (6) An Online Electronic Platform Company, (7) An Oil Transportation Service, (8) Solar Panel Performance Testing Service Business, (9) An Infrastructure and Utility.

Nature of business operations

(1) Operation and Maintenance Business

ESCO - EGCO’s wholly owned subsidiary which provides operation, maintenance, engineering and construction services to power plants, petrochemical plants, oil refineries and other industries.

E&E - EGCO indirectly holds 40% stake in E&E Engineering and Service Company Limited, which provides operation and maintenance services to NT1PC power plant through a long-term operation and maintenance agreement and provides the various service to other power plants and industries in the Laos PDR.

PEPOI - EGCO indirectly holds 100% stake in PEPOI, which provides operation and maintenance services for Quezon and SBPL power plant through a long-term operation and maintenance agreement.

(2) Management Services Business for Power Plant

EGCO indirectly holds 100% stake in QMS, which provides management services for Quezon and SBPL power plant through a long-term management service agreement.

(3) Coal Mining Business

EGCO indirectly holds 40% stake in MME, which owns and operates a coal mining project (an open-pit mine), located in Muara Enim, South Sumatra, Indonesia. It is awarded a concession agreement from Indonesian government for 28 years since March 2010 to March 2038. It has mineable coal reserves of 134 million tons.

(4) LNG Shipper Business

The Energy Regulatory Commission (ERC) approved EGCO to acquire the LNG Shipper License to import the Liquefied Natural Gas (LNG) in the greatest amount of 200,380 tons per year with 10 years. Enable to supply of such fuel to the 3 Small Power Plants (SPPs) in EGCO, comprising 1) Banpong power plant in Ratchaburi province, 2) Klongluang power plant in Pathum Thani province, and 3) EGCO Cogeneration power plant in Rayong province.

(5) A Clean Energy Project Development

EGCO indirectly holds 17.46 % stake in APEX TopCo which is a private utility scale renewable development company, located in the State of Virginia in USA. Its business is based upon the development of renewable projects through the point of Notice to Proceed (“NTP”) for construction or up to the project’s Commercial Operation Date (“COD”), and the subsequent sale of these projects to third party investors.

(6) An Online Electronic Platform Company

EGCO holds 24.24% stake in Peer Power Company Limited. Peer Power is a fintech startup, focusing on an online electronic platform for bond and equity crowdfunding that connects investors to Small and Medium-sized Enterprises.

(7) An Oil Transportation Service

EGCO holds 44.6% stake in TPN, which is an oil transportation service that utilizes a pipeline network to deliver oil to the Northeastern Region of Thailand. The pipeline system covers a total distance of 342 kilometers and boasts an annual transport capacity of up to 5,443 million liters. This infrastructure facilitates a connection between the storage facility of Thai Petroleum Pipeline Co., Ltd. (“Thappline”) in Saraburi Province and TPN’s proprietary storage terminal, capable of holding 157 million liters, located in the Ban Phai District of Khon Kaen Province.

(8) Solar Panel Performance Testing Service Business

EGCO indirectly holds 60% stake in RES, which is a service provider for solar panel testing conducted by internationally certified operators and laboratory.

(9) An Infrastructure and Utility

EGCO indirectly holds 30% stake in CDI, which is an infrastructure and utility investment company with a portfolio of various businesses, encompassing electricity generation and distribution, water supply, storage/tank, and jetty management and logistic
